Dodgers

NEWS: Dustin May was placed on the IL with lower back tightness. 

IMPACT: High

BHQ SPIN: This puts May out for the remainder of the season, with rookie Michael Grove (4.66 ERA, 18/7 K/BB through 19 IP) remaining in the rotation in his place for now. Currently rehabbing Tony Gonsolin (strained forearm) may also make a final start before year-end, depending on his rehab progress. The LA rotation will be extremely fluid over the week-and-a-half remaining.
